Ryan Yin
|
fd62548dc0
|
feat(home/base/tui/editors/neovim): astronvim v4 - comment some demo
|
2024-04-13 23:10:26 +08:00 |
|
Ryan Yin
|
9a45cc6448
|
feat(home/base/tui/editors/neovim): astronvim v4 - gT => gy
|
2024-04-13 23:10:26 +08:00 |
|
Ryan Yin
|
ac844a6a3d
|
feat(home/base/tui/editors/neovim): astronvim v4 - leader => Leader
|
2024-04-13 23:10:26 +08:00 |
|
Ryan Yin
|
c5dcc7e24d
|
feat(home/base/tui/editors/neovim): upgrade astronvim to v4
|
2024-04-13 23:10:26 +08:00 |
|
Ryan Yin
|
a593435947
|
fix: atunin with nushell
https://github.com/ryan4yin/nix-config/issues/119
|
2024-04-13 23:09:35 +08:00 |
|
Ryan Yin
|
0b9574d693
|
fix: 'rnix-lsp' has been removed as it is unmaintained
|
2024-04-12 23:15:06 +08:00 |
|
Ryan Yin
|
93c423a75b
|
feat: update flake.nix
|
2024-04-12 23:15:06 +08:00 |
|
DataEraserC
|
0b7d6428e0
|
fix(neovim typo): fix typo in the comment of astronvim_user/init.lua
|
2024-04-11 01:32:19 +08:00 |
|
Ryan Yin
|
e6f6042c3c
|
fix: remove some broken packages from darwin
|
2024-04-09 22:35:23 +08:00 |
|
Ryan Yin
|
b8ce5573f5
|
feat: remove attic, it works not well
|
2024-04-09 22:35:23 +08:00 |
|
Ryan Yin
|
74b948a722
|
feat: add virt-viewer
|
2024-04-01 14:38:40 +08:00 |
|
Ryan Yin
|
0eb83b22f0
|
chore(All Markdown Files): auto wrap text, fix typos
|
2024-03-16 19:49:46 +08:00 |
|
Ryan Yin
|
4d3a3750c1
|
feat: add develop environment for ruby
|
2024-03-14 00:33:38 +08:00 |
|
Ryan Yin
|
1437170127
|
refactor: remove broken packages via overlays
|
2024-03-11 14:16:19 +08:00 |
|
Ryan Yin
|
5af7c7a427
|
fix: aarch64-darwin - fern
|
2024-03-11 11:56:33 +08:00 |
|
Ryan Yin
|
b29b7e8624
|
fix: x86_64-darwin - harmonica
|
2024-03-11 00:28:57 +08:00 |
|
Ryan Yin
|
b382999a70
|
refactor: Use haumea for filesystem-based module system for flake outputs
refactor: Use hyphen(`-`) for variable names & folder names(except Python), replace all unserscore(`_`) with hyphen(`-`).
|
2024-03-10 20:12:02 +08:00 |
|
Ryan Yin
|
3247e4a8e6
|
refactor: use lib.optionals instead of if...then...else...
|
2024-03-08 23:16:45 +08:00 |
|
Ryan Yin
|
2b8d059ecc
|
feat: add gitops tools
|
2024-03-08 17:06:40 +08:00 |
|
Ryan Yin
|
d59061e526
|
feat: nix related tools
|
2024-03-05 14:37:59 +08:00 |
|
Ryan Yin
|
b4015c2189
|
feat: add attic - a self-hosted nix cache server
|
2024-03-04 02:35:00 +08:00 |
|
Ryan Yin
|
f141b49dc3
|
feat: kubevirt on k3s
|
2024-03-03 12:06:25 +08:00 |
|
Ryan Yin
|
7d56db3e47
|
fix: pip mirror - sjtu -> ustc
|
2024-03-03 12:04:10 +08:00 |
|
Sacabambaspis
|
fa5b1b2752
|
Fix boolean expectation error and update conditional checks.
|
2024-03-03 00:25:04 +08:00 |
|
Ryan Yin
|
fcde4b8e83
|
feat: update ssh.nix
|
2024-02-28 09:02:24 +08:00 |
|
Ryan Yin
|
8deb3f809b
|
feat: install colmena & ventoy at user-level
|
2024-02-27 21:36:23 +08:00 |
|
Ryan Yin
|
bff316ab7e
|
fix: nixpkgs's joplin not work on macOS intel
|
2024-02-27 21:24:09 +08:00 |
|
Ryan Yin
|
f0217c68f5
|
feat: note-taking - joplin
|
2024-02-19 15:05:24 +08:00 |
|
Ryan Yin
|
64205a79fd
|
feat: add pulumi related tools
|
2024-02-18 23:05:31 +08:00 |
|
Ryan Yin
|
9a71920fd4
|
fix: k9s skin
|
2024-02-18 22:30:56 +08:00 |
|
Ryan Yin
|
ae238d401d
|
fix: bypass router
|
2024-02-17 04:36:41 +08:00 |
|
Ryan Yin
|
45c6d0f604
|
feat: update flake.lock, fix some api/package changes
|
2024-02-16 10:09:31 +08:00 |
|
Ryan Yin
|
2db93b7b01
|
feat: sjtu's mirror for pypi
|
2024-02-09 19:09:46 +08:00 |
|
Ryan Yin
|
3f9d23dbad
|
fix: gpg: [stdin]: encryption failed: Unusable public key
|
2024-01-31 11:45:47 +08:00 |
|
Ryan Yin
|
90cd503219
|
feat: use gpg only for pass & ssh, make public keys & trust immutable
|
2024-01-27 17:14:14 +08:00 |
|
Ryan Yin
|
a0e00c5453
|
feat: do not import gpg public keys automatically
|
2024-01-27 17:09:10 +08:00 |
|
Ryan Yin
|
05682dbac9
|
feat: security - password-store, gpg, age, etc...
|
2024-01-27 16:56:57 +08:00 |
|
Ryan Yin
|
b9b9a55ede
|
fix: revert password-store cloning
|
2024-01-27 10:33:42 +08:00 |
|
Ryan Yin
|
b75195d339
|
feat: clone password-store if it not exists yet
|
2024-01-26 22:37:05 +08:00 |
|
Ryan Yin
|
c02590c07a
|
docs: gpg
|
2024-01-26 18:38:31 +08:00 |
|
Ryan Yin
|
ecc335b07e
|
feat: security - gnupg & openssh's KDF
|
2024-01-26 13:47:01 +08:00 |
|
Ryan Yin
|
7e36360550
|
feat: set mirror for pip
|
2024-01-25 15:05:01 +08:00 |
|
Ryan Yin
|
62505e4488
|
feat: add croc for file transfering, and age/sops for file encryption
|
2024-01-23 13:36:25 +08:00 |
|
Ryan Yin
|
8d69b2907f
|
docs: helix
|
2024-01-23 11:41:44 +08:00 |
|
Ryan Yin
|
9843ea9db5
|
feat: morden cli tools
|
2024-01-22 15:36:08 +08:00 |
|
Ryan Yin
|
f51242ae08
|
feat: morden cli tools
|
2024-01-22 15:27:09 +08:00 |
|
Ryan Yin
|
4f1c138a01
|
refactor: container & kubernetes
|
2024-01-22 14:32:05 +08:00 |
|
Ryan Yin
|
c90317a84b
|
feat: add lazygit & lazydocker
|
2024-01-22 10:41:33 +08:00 |
|
Ryan Yin
|
d559655e26
|
docs: emacs - magit
|
2024-01-21 22:24:20 +08:00 |
|
Ryan Yin
|
cba3212896
|
fix: statix fix
|
2024-01-21 17:07:44 +08:00 |
|